The Pelott insole has been developed to relieve and redistribute pressure in the forefoot for various types of forefoot problems. By lifting the forefoot arch, it helps to reduce pressure on the metatarsal heads and thereby lessen the load on the ball of the foot.
The T-shaped pad provides targeted and controlled relief that promotes a more even distribution of pressure under load. The design contributes to improved biomechanics in the forefoot and can thus reduce pain in conditions such as Morton’s neuroma, hallux valgus and hammer toe.
A key and unique feature of this pad sole is that the pad’s size, height and firmness are adapted to the sole’s size. This is crucial for achieving optimal effect, as a smaller foot exerts a different load on the pad than a larger one. Smaller sizes therefore have a lower, softer pad, whilst larger sizes have a higher and more stable pad to handle increased load. This differentiation ensures more personalised pressure relief and consistent treatment results regardless of foot size.
The insole’s 3/4 design allows for easy application in various types of shoes without affecting toe box space. The self-adhesive underside ensures stable positioning, even in shoes with heels. The construction in dimensionally stable PU foam, combined with a leather surface layer, provides both good shock absorption and high comfort during use.
The pad insole is recommended for forefoot problems where relief of the forefoot arch and forefoot pad is necessary. The Pelott insole can be used in all types of footwear, including everyday shoes, formal shoes, and sports and fitness shoes.
